NVIDIA RTX 5090 slimmer than 4090

Kopite7kimi corroborates on next-gen RTX 50 cooler rumors.

Last week, it was revealed that the NVIDIA RTX 5090 PCB will be more complex than the RTX 40 series. Instead of featuring a single board, the RTX 50 series will use three interconnected boards. This design is specific to the Founders Edition model from NVIDIA and may not be used in the reference models from other manufacturers.

NVIDIA likely had strong reasons for opting for such a complex cooler design for the RTX 5090. Prototypes for the GB202 Blackwell GPU, seemingly designed for the upcoming flagship RTX 5090, suggest it will occupy only two slots . This is a significant reduction compared to the bulky RTX 4090 Founders Edition or custom 4090 models, which typically take up 3 to 4 slots.

Kopite also clarified that despite the slimmer design, the Founders Edition would still only have two fans .

Speculating about the RTX 5090’s specifications might be premature, but here’s what we know so far: The full GB202 GPU is expected to have up to 192 Streaming Multiprocessors. Similar to the RTX 4090, the 5090 will likely have fewer cores than the full chip, though the exact number is still unknown.

What’s more certain is that the RTX 5090 will likely use a 512-bit memory bus. The memory capacity, however, depends on whether NVIDIA opts for 2GB or 3GB modules, as per JEDEC specifications. This means the card could end up with either 32GB or 24GB of memory. Rumors suggest the PCB is designed to support 16 GDDR7 modules, making the 32GB option more probable.

NVIDIA is not expected to make any announcements during the pre-Computex keynote this weekend. However, more details are likely to emerge over the summer, as the RTX 50 series is expected to be available by the end of the year.
